Output 3c5f397c07b61bec317eb25df1e656d2bf9663f704b7ba4d96383032a9a4ca8e:1

value
1569986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5543a224ec2c14ed7c67454c7f0645a40707627d OP_EQUAL
address
39TrP6gDJ4fvwsMh3Bs4rRHWZdMoxbxLpN
transaction
3c5f397c07b61bec317eb25df1e656d2bf9663f704b7ba4d96383032a9a4ca8e
confirmations
300104
spent
true